To solve this equation (correct me if i'm wrong), you could first multiply the bottom equation by 3, to get 15y. After that, we get -4x-15y=-17 and -3x + 15y=-39, and if we add the 2 equations up, on top of each other, we get -7x=-56, and we can conclude that x=8, and with substitution (-32 - 15y = -17), we know that y=(-1)


Here's what I mean by on-top


-4x-15y=-17

-3x + 15y=-39


-7x=-56
